In the vibrant intellectual landscape of the 18th century, few figures embodied the spirit of the Enlightenment quite like Jean Huber. Born in Geneva, a city steeped in both scientific rigor and artistic refinement, Huber was far more than a mere painter; he was a polymath whose creative reach extended into the realms of literature, satire, and even military service. His life, spanning from 1744 to 1786, was a tapestry woven with threads of precision and whimsy. While his early years were shaped by the disciplined atmosphere of Swiss heritage, his artistic soul sought the freedom found in movement, light, and the delicate edges of shadow. This duality—the soldier’s discipline meeting the artist’s curiosity—allowed him to capture the world with an unparalleled eye for both the grand and the minute.
Huber’s journey was deeply intertwined with the great thinkers of his era, most notably the philosopher Voltaire. This connection provided more than just social prestige; it offered a window into the burgeoning cultural shifts of Europe. Through his interactions with the intellectual elite, Huber’s work began to reflect the era's fascination with naturalism and social commentary. His ability to blend the observational accuracy required for scientific study with the biting wit of caricature made him a unique voice in an age of profound transformation. Whether he was documenting the anatomy of a creature or sketching a satirical portrait of a contemporary, Huber’s hand remained guided by a profound respect for the truth of his subject.
The true hallmark of Huber’s artistic legacy lies in his revolutionary approach to portraiture and his mastery of the silhouette. Before the advent of photography, the silhouette offered a captivating way to capture the essence of a human profile through stark, elegant contrast. Huber did not merely practice this technique; he championed it, elevating it from a simple craft to a sophisticated art form. By stripping away the distractions of color and complex shading, he focused the viewer's attention on the pure geometry of the face and the evocative power of the outline. This minimalist approach required an extraordinary level of precision, as every curve and contour had to be perfectly rendered to convey character and emotion.
Beyond the delicate profiles that defined his portraiture, Huber possessed a remarkable talent for capturing the raw energy of the natural world. His studies of animals and hunting scenes were characterized by a profound sensitivity to texture and motion. He had an uncanny ability to render the sheen of a horse's coat or the tension in a predator's muscles, utilizing subtle gradations of light that hinted at the sfumato techniques of the Old Masters. His work often felt alive, as if the viewer had stumbled upon a fleeting moment in the wild. This mastery of detail was complemented by his skill in caricature, where he used his keen observational powers to create satirical works that poked fun at the social hierarchies and eccentricities of 18th-century life.
The significance of Jean Huber extends far beyond the borders of Switzerland. He remains a pivotal figure in the history of European art, representing a bridge between the classical traditions of the past and the modern, observational styles that would emerge in the centuries to follow.
